What Happens If You Ignore a Blown Car Fuse?

A blown car fuse is designed to sacrifice itself to protect more expensive electrical components from damage. When a fuse blows, it means an excessive amount of electrical current has flowed through it, causing the internal wire to melt and break the circuit. This action prevents a potential fire or damage to systems like your headlights, radio, power windows, or even vital engine control modules.

The Immediate Consequences of a Blown Fuse

When a fuse blows, the device or system it protects immediately stops working. This is the most obvious sign. For example:

  • Your headlights might go out, creating a dangerous driving situation at night.
  • Your car radio could fall silent, leaving you without entertainment or important traffic updates.
  • Power windows might refuse to budge, trapping you inside or preventing you from closing them.
  • Dashboard warning lights could illuminate, indicating a fault in a specific system.

These are often considered minor annoyances, but they are direct indicators of an underlying electrical issue.

Escalating Problems from Neglect

If you ignore a blown fuse and the underlying cause persists, the problems can quickly escalate. The initial overload that blew the fuse might be a symptom of a larger electrical fault. Continuing to drive without addressing it can lead to:

  • Damage to Other Electrical Components: The same surge that blew one fuse could stress other components, leading to premature failure. This can be incredibly expensive to repair, as modern car electronics are complex and integrated.
  • Wiring Harness Damage: Repeated electrical surges or short circuits can overheat and melt the insulation on your car’s wiring harness. This can cause intermittent electrical gremlins, corrosion, and even create fire hazards.
  • System Malfunctions: Critical systems like your anti-lock braking system (ABS), airbags, or engine management system rely on electrical signals. A persistent electrical fault can cause these systems to malfunction, compromising your safety.
  • Battery Drain: While less common, some electrical faults can cause a continuous drain on your car battery, leading to a dead battery and leaving you stranded.

The Risk of a Car Fire

Perhaps the most severe consequence of ignoring a blown fuse is the risk of a car fire. Fuses are the last line of defense against electrical fires. When a fuse blows, it indicates a significant electrical problem, such as a short circuit where wires are frayed or improperly connected. If this issue isn’t resolved, the excessive heat generated by the faulty wiring can ignite surrounding materials, leading to a dangerous fire.

Why Do Car Fuses Blow?

Understanding why a fuse blows is key to appreciating the importance of addressing it. Common reasons include:

  • Electrical Overload: Too many accessories are drawing power from a single circuit.
  • Short Circuit: A positive wire touches a ground wire or the metal chassis of the car, creating a path of very low resistance and a massive surge of current. This is often caused by damaged wiring.
  • Faulty Component: The electrical device itself (e.g., a motor in a power window) has failed internally, causing it to draw too much current.
  • Corrosion: Corroded electrical connections can increase resistance, leading to overheating and eventually a blown fuse.

Troubleshooting a Blown Fuse

When you discover a blown fuse, the immediate step is to replace it with a new one of the exact same amperage rating. Never use a fuse with a higher rating, as this defeats its protective purpose and can cause severe damage or fire.

However, simply replacing the fuse is often not enough. If the new fuse blows immediately or shortly after replacement, it confirms the underlying problem still exists. This is when you need to investigate further or seek professional help.

What is the most common reason for a car fuse to blow?

The most common reasons for a car fuse to blow are an electrical overload, where too many devices are drawing power from one circuit, or a short circuit, where a wire accidentally touches a metal part of the car, creating a sudden surge of current. These events trigger the fuse to break the circuit and protect other components.

Can a blown fuse cause my car not to start?

Yes, a blown fuse can absolutely prevent your car from starting. Many vehicles have specific fuses that protect the starter motor circuit, the fuel pump, or the engine control unit (ECU). If one of these critical fuses blows, the necessary systems won’t receive power, and the engine won’t crank or start.

How do I know which fuse is blown in my car?

Most cars have a fuse box diagram located in the owner’s manual or on the fuse box cover itself. This diagram labels each fuse and the system it protects. You can visually inspect fuses for a broken or melted wire inside, or use a multimeter or fuse tester to check for continuity.

Is it safe to drive with a blown fuse?

It is generally not safe to drive with a blown fuse, especially if it controls a critical safety system like headlights, brakes, or airbags. While some blown fuses might only affect non-essential features like the radio, others can lead to dangerous situations or further damage to your vehicle’s electrical system, increasing the risk of breakdowns or accidents.

What happens if I replace a blown fuse with a higher amperage one?

Replacing a blown fuse with one of a higher amperage rating is extremely dangerous. The fuse’s amperage rating is its protective limit. A higher-rated fuse will not blow when it should, allowing excessive current to flow. This can overheat wires, melt insulation, damage expensive electrical components, and significantly increase the risk of a fire.
